📝 Color Information for #6CA374

The hexadecimal color code #6CA374 represents a medium shade in the green family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 108 red, 163 green, and 116 blue, which translates to approximately 42% red, 64% green, and 45% blue. This makes it a slightly desaturated color with cool und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#6CA374 has a hue of 129 degrees, a saturation level of 23%, and a lightness value of 53%. The hue angle of 129° places this color firmly in the green sp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 129°, saturation of 34%, and brightness/value of 64%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#6CA374 would be reproduced using 34% cyan, 0% magenta, 29% yellow, and 36% black. The closest web-safe color is #669966,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. With its medium lightness, it's versatile enough for both foreground elements and subtle backgrounds. The moderate to low saturation gives this color a sophisticated, muted quality that works well in professional and minimalist designs. When pairing #6CA374 with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 309°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 7119732,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#6CA374? +

The approximate CMYK value of #6CA374 is C:34% M:0% Y:29% K:36%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
